Ticket #4417 — ProctorFlow queue stuck again

Hey Marisol, the exam-proctoring intake queue on ProctorFlow stopped draining around 09:40 because the worker's credentials expired overnight. Candidates at the Kestrel Ridge testing site are piling up in pending state, so this is blocking the 2.3 release sign-off. I've already minted a replacement credential via the VaultBird console and confirmed the scopes match. To unblock, swap the worker config to use the new key below.

gateway credential: zpat15_lMLOSdhT94y0U3l

Subject: Handover — Larkspur SFTP drop

Hey future release folks — quick handover note. The weekly export to our partner Velmore lands via their SFTP drop every Thursday night; if the push fails, just rerun the uploader job, it's idempotent. One gotcha: the drop rejects unsigned bundles. The deploy key you need is right below.

release key, kaweg-yawif: bky6_xXFRJ1

## Authentication

Heads up: the nightly reindex job (`reindex_nightly.py`) talks to the Lanternfish search cluster, and that cluster won't accept anonymous writes anymore — we locked it down last sprint. The job now authenticates as the `reindex-runner` service identity against Corvid Gateway, and the token is injected via the `LF_INDEX_TOKEN` env var in the scheduler config. Nothing clever going on, just a bearer header on every batch request. For review purposes, the staging credential currently in use is listed below.

service key, kadug-kadup: kto15_rN23XLAYImmZgrJ

### Changelog — Fennwick API v5.0: pagination defaults

Starting with this release, all list endpoints in the Fennwick public REST API use cursor pagination by default. Offset pagination still works if the client passes the legacy parameter, but it is deprecated and will be removed in a later major version. If you are new to the codebase, note that the defaults are defined centrally rather than per endpoint, so a single change propagates everywhere. The defaults shipping in this release are listed below.

settings of tagef-bawif:
DRUIX_HOST=druix.zemvarlabs.internal
DRUIX_PORT=8000